Sam and others in the engineering team have spent the last few weeks in Colorado, testing the co-solvent module on cannabis. They found that the extraction speed was increased by 300%! This is a game changer for our customers since the module can be retrofitted to most of our existing systems. Our co-solvent
injection module can also be added as a standalone component to any non-Apeks
CO2 Extraction systems as well. Contact us to find out more!

A reminder of the advantages:
-
Ability to inject 0-5%
ethanol into the CO2 stream during a run
- Up to a 66% shorter
extraction time (300% faster!) depending on parameter
- Selectable Injection
time, start it after the terp run or even after initial crude run to
squeeze out more
- Will include CO2 Flow
Meter
- 100% controls
integration
- Easier Separator
Cleanout

Did you know that our control panels are UL Listed for both the United States and for Canada? All our panels are built to combined US and Canadian UL specifications.
To quote from the UL website directly: "There are multiple variations of marks for UL’s Listing service, some of which are for use in the United States, others for use in Canada and still others for use in both markets. Products carrying marks for Canada have been evaluated to Canadian safety requirements, which may be somewhat different from U.S. safety requirements. A combination mark indicates compliance with both Canadian and U.S. requirements."
